Role Overview
This internship places you with a global consumer goods leader in Singapore, where you will use data, science, and technology to help answer important business questions. The role is geared toward someone who is analytical, curious, confident, and eager to drive meaningful outcomes.
The data science function partners across the business to turn technical capability into practical value. Interns can expect exposure to strategic business problems, modern tools, and a collaborative environment that values initiative and communication.
What You Will Work On
- Contribute either to a central data science group working on shared analytics challenges across supply chain, retail, and media, or to an embedded team focused on eCommerce and consumer-facing problems for a specific brand.
- Take on real project responsibilities from the beginning, including clarifying business goals and producing actionable insights from datasets such as point-of-sale, geospatial, product and supply, direct-to-consumer, CRM, TV media, and online search data across more than 10 countries in the region.
- Develop, validate, test, and deploy machine learning or other data science models into internal technology platforms.
Learning and Support
The internship offers practical exposure to industry-level analytics tools and technologies from day one. You will also receive structured training and ongoing mentoring from professionals in IT and data science while working with cross-functional teams.
Eligibility and Qualifications
- You should be a student expected to graduate in July 2026 and able to complete a full-time 6-month internship from January to June 2026.
- A strong academic record is expected for candidates pursuing a Bachelor's degree or higher in Computer Science, Mathematics, Economics, Statistics, Applied Science, or another quantitatively oriented discipline.
- Strong Python skills are required; familiarity with big data environments and Spark is an advantage.
- Exposure to operations research methods such as optimization and simulation, as well as machine learning approaches like tree-based models, deep learning, and reinforcement learning, is preferred.
- Prior use of machine learning, statistical modelling, or econometrics through coursework or internship experience is expected.
- Excellent written and spoken communication skills are needed to influence others and drive action.
- You should be comfortable working with people from different functions, backgrounds, and experience levels.
- Strong analytical thinking, problem-solving ability, and a proactive, can-do mindset are important.
- The ability to manage several priorities at once is required.
